95 jeep dying
 
"95 Jeep GC 6 cyl

When making a sharp turn forward or reverse the engin dies. Does anyone
have any ideas what may cause this?


Mike Romain 09-11-2006 09:39 AM

Re: 95 jeep dying
 
I would look close at the wiring where it is near the exhaust. There
are some sensor wires that pass across the exhaust cross over pipe
underneath also.

I would be suspecting one of these wires is shorting out when you turn.
